About the Role

We are seeking a strategic and detail-oriented Regulatory Intelligence (RI) Manager to join the Regulatory Intelligence function at Bionical Emas. This role focuses on Early Access Programs (EAPs), including expanded access, compassionate use, named-patient supply, and other pre-approval access mechanisms. The RI Manager is responsible for monitoring, analyzing, and communicating global regulatory developments and policies that impact access to unlicensed medicines. This position plays a pivotal role in maintaining the company’s world-class regulatory intelligence database, ensuring that regulatory content and processes are consistently robust, current, and actionable. The insights generated will directly support timely and compliant access to medicines across diverse international markets, providing detailed and operationally relevant intelligence that enables cross-functional teams to navigate complex regulatory landscapes with confidence. The RI Manager will play a key role in ensuring the integrity, usability, and continuous improvement of regulatory intelligence systems and processes. This includes managing data inputs, maintaining high standards of accuracy, and contributing to system enhancements that align with evolving needs. The role will also be responsible for delivery of client projects.
